The invention discloses an intelligent full-automatic aquaculture material-feeding device and a material feeding method thereof, and belongs to the technical field of aquaculture. The device includesa hull, two power propellers, N silos, a material mixing chamber and a nozzle assembly, wherein the two power propellers are symmetrically installed on both sides of the hull, the N silos are adjacently fixed on the hull through brackets, and the silos are separately used for accommodating materials of particles, powder, tablets and liquids; and the material mixing chamber is arranged horizontallybelow the silos, and communicates with the outlets of the silos at the same time through connecting pipes, and the nozzle assembly is fixed at the outlet of the material mixing chamber, and extends out of the hull, and is used for spraying the materials in the material mixing chamber into a pool. The material mixing chamber is arranged before spraying, the material mixing chamber is capable of fully mixing granular materials with a liquid on the premise of no damage to the granular materials, and can also be used for separating the granular materials according to the particle size, small granules can be sprayed directly, and large granules must be turned into small granules, and then are sprayed, so that the problem of clogging of nozzles is solved, and large-area spraying is achieved.
